Just an FYI for the DCT owners. The newest update I just got seems to smooth out the low speed shifting into 2nd gear. Where the original "fix" for the LONG delay was an aggressive blip of the throttle and then engaging 2nd, it seems like less of a blip and second is engage more smoothly.
